Quality Digital Innovation Senior Specialist (FTC/Secondment)
Job Purpose
To provide Oversight and Leadership of the data provision process. To ensure the accuracy and consistency of data provision. To drive improvements to the provision of data in all function both in terms of quality and speed.
This is a FTC/Secondment for the duration of 18 months.
Key Responsibilities
- Ensure that data provision is consistent and accurate
- Provide oversight of data provision quality ensuring that data provision is performed in line with procedures
- Provide advice and support throughout site with respect to SAP data provision
- Ensure the adoption of the simplified, standardised SAP solution, minimizing customisation and maximising the adoption of embedded standard Systems, Applications, and Products (SAP) good practices
- Working with core SAP functions to introduce new core functionality and to escalate risks as appropriate
- Identify opportunities for improvement within the data provision and approval functions
- Develop Change Improvement Frameworks and actions to address improvements
- Development and delivery of training materials with respect to SAP data provision to improve the capability of the site
Basic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in Science or Engineering or in these related fields.
- Experience in the pharmaceutical industry in Quality Assurance, Validation, Production processes
- Experience in reviewing, interpreting and approving critical production data, and working across multiple areas.
Preferred Qualifications
- Master’s degree in a Science or Engineering related discipline such as Quality Assurance, Validation, Production processes
- Excel and Data Processing Skills
- Leadership and team working skills are key to the effective fulfilment of the role.
- Ability to overcome obstacles and barriers to success and deliver quality and efficiency in all aspects of the business, within the compliance and regulatory framework.
- Knowledge of SAP and Digital Systems, their overall function and operation
- Detailed knowledge of the site Quality Management Systems and the interaction of digital platforms across the business
- Ability to work cross-functionally both in and outside of quality
- Ability to convey complex Systems, Applications, and Products (SAP) functionality in a simple way to personnel across the business at all levels of capability

Why GSK?
Uniting science, technology and talent to get ahead of disease together.
GSK is a global biopharma company with a purpose to unite science, technology and talent to get ahead of disease together. We aim to positively impact the health of 2.5 billion people by the end of the decade, as a successful, growing company where people can thrive.
We get ahead of disease by preventing and treating it with innovation in specialty medicines and vaccines. We focus on four therapeutic areas: respiratory, immunology and inflammation; oncology; HIV; and infectious diseases – to impact health at scale.
